Controlling the way your home is heated is one of the better ways to reduce expensive energy expenses and leave you with far more disposable income at the end of each month. After all, 60% of your power bill is from heating the home, so it's definitely an excellent place to start.

With the right controls you'll have the ability to keep your household at a comfy temperature, while simultaneously not throwing away additional money on fuel. You'll likewise be able to keep your house carbon emissions down too.

The good news is, heating control systems can be used with any boiler, regardless of the type or age. This suggests there's a saving to make if you just go out there and get it.

By setting up a heating control system it can save you in between £70 and £150 annually. Moreover there are a lot of CO2 emissions to be reduced as well and you may cut between 310kg and 630kg each year.

Also think about the temperature you have your thermostat fixed on. By just turning it down one degree, you can save up to £75 each year and won't feel a difference in temperature either.

Chigwell is a civil parish and town within the Epping Forest district of Essex. It's positioned on an outlying suburb of London, situated 12 miles (19 kilometres) north-east of Charing Cross. Along with the adjoining suburban areas of Loughton and Buckhurst Hill, Chigwell forms a part of the area known as the 'golden triangle' of Essex. The hamlet of Chigwell Row lies towards the east of Chigwell, close to Lambourne. This section of the parish is densely forested and predominantly rural. Grange Hill is the location surrounding the junction of Manor Road and Fencepiece Road/Hainault Road, spreading as far as the boundary with Redbridge and the Limes Farm estate. Chigwell features a population of around 12500 and is usually viewed as a wealthy area, which since the television series Essex Wives, journalists have called (with Loughton and Buckhurst Hill), the Essex golden triangle. The town is characterised by big suburban homes, notably in Manor Road, Hainault Road and Chigwell High Road, which featured in the well-liked English situation comedy Birds of a Feather. You will find many sports and leisure facilities available to the town's 12987 residents. A David Lloyd Leisure Centre is situated off Roding Road by the M11 motorway, which includes indoor and outdoor tennis courts, swimming pools and gymnasium. Also within the area are a Holmes Place Health Club, Topgolf playing Centre and Chigwell Golf Club. Chigwell Cricket Club is based at the Old Chigwellians Club in Roding Lane. You'll find two pubs, The King William IV plus the Two Brewers. There is a Local Nature Reserve at Roding Valley Meadows off Roding Lane which follows the River Roding up to Loughton. does nest thermostat work with oil boiler?

The simple answer to this question is yes. The Google Nest thermostats are built in such way that makes it compatible with most 24V systems including the older systems. The device is functional with all common types of fuel such as electricity,natural gas as well as oil. However, before purchase it is vital to determine if your thermostat is also compatible. What’s more? The Nest thermostats is also designed to be usable even without the existence of a C wire (common wire) in your home, although a new C wire installation may be required.

Furthermore, Nest Learning Thermostat is compatible with multiple central heating system such as combi boiler systems, air source and ground source heat pumps (heating only) as well as heat only boiler. Now let’s take a look at the Nest thermostat compatibility!

• The majority of the 24 V systems ( including older systems) are compatible with Google Nest thermostat. They can be incorporated with each and every common types of fuel such as oil, natural gas as well as electricity.

• Prior to the installation of Google Nest thermostat, you can make use of the Google Home or Nest app for proper guidance and to notify you if your system is compatible. It will also give you a bespoke thermostat wiring guide.

• To check the compatibility of your system, you can also check with the Google’s online compatibility checker before purchase.

do smart thermostats save money?

If you’re looking to acquire smart thermostats in your home, but wondering about its money saving qualities, then this is for you! Not only do smart thermostats add new impressive features to your home, but it can also save you both energy and money. According to many reports using a programmable thermostat can save you between the range of £130 to £150 on an annual basis. Now think about using a smart thermostat that makes it a lot more easier for you.

Wondering how smart thermostat save money? Simply set your smart thermostat one or two degrees lower or higher than the usual number. Once done, you’re likely to notice 1% to 3% reduction in your energy bills. And if you want even more, you simply increase the percentage to about 10 degrees to 15 degrees to cover the period you spend at work and watch as you save up to 10 percent of your energy bills.

Generally, a smart thermostats will save you money in two major ways. These includes:

• They Do All The Thinking For You

The smart thermostat watches your behaviour and study the time you’re at home and when you’re not as well as your preferred temperature at particular times in a day, and that’s why they are termed as “smart. they’ll automatically adjust the settings to ensure you get home to a perfect temperature.

• They Keep Tabs On Your Usage

You can always count on a two way communicating smart thermostat to watch your usage while also collecting the data and sharing it with you. It informs you of your energy usage rate as well as the estimated amount. Once you’ve been notified, you can manual adjustment or leave it to the thermostat to help manage your energy.

how to install nest thermostat?

Installing your Nest thermostat may not be as easy as screwing a light bulb, but we can also assure you that it isn’t very difficult either. However, if you lack the needed training or experience to pull it off, we’d recommend you hire the services of a professional in order to save yourself some time and money. This guide will give you some quick and easy steps to follow and ensure you make no errors during the installation process.

Once installed removing the Nest Thermostat can be done. To get started, you’ll need just a Philips head screwdriver which Nest has thoughtfully provided with the device.

• Turn off the Nest Thermostat by switching the circuit breaker to the off position.

• Label or mark your old thermostat’s wires. However, if you notice your thermostat is tagged 120v or 240v, or possesses thick wires, do not connect the wires to the Nest as you have a high voltage system.

• Uninstall the old thermostat by locating detaching the wires coming out from the wall into the thermostat. Once done, simply unscrew the device from the wall

• Mark the spot of your thermostat. Do this by threading wires through the Nest base plate’s centre incorporate the tiny bubble level. Once done, you can then use a pencil to mark te two screw holes.

• Attach the trim plate. If you wish to cover the screw holes, simply install the trim plate in the Nest box’s bottom to the base plate.

• Using the screws and screwdriver, attach the Nest base to the wall.

• Connect the wires to the Nest by putting the labelled wires in the Nest’s corresponding ports.

• Put the Nest display by lining up the connector on the display’s back.

• Turn on the power by switching the circuit breaker to the on position

• Connect your Nest thermostat to the WiFi network.

• Follow the on-screen guide and set the temperature.

• Use your smartphone or tablet to download the Nest thermostat’s mobile app to monitor and control your device remotely.
